RBI BONDS
The RBI Bond is a popular investment instruments for a variety of reasons:
They comes closest to being risk free among all investment instruments.
They offer attractive interest rate (when considered with the risk element incorporated in other investment
  instruments).
The interest income is totally tax free.
Existence of a secondary market in them lends liquidity.
Most banks/institutions offer loans against these bonds, given its sovereign rating.
Indeed, the RBI Bonds are very attractive investment opportunity for individuals looking at investing in very low risk bearing instruments.

SYSTEMATIC INVESTMENT PLAN
A systematic investment plan keeps you investing during those months where you could use some extra cash and might be tempted to forego putting money aside. Take some comfort from people who have long had money automatically withdrawn from their checking or saving accounts: most of them say they no longer even miss the money.

Some mutual fund companies offer investers systematic savings plans where an invester can enter into a contract to make monthly deposits.These plans force an investor to adhere to this savings regimen for a long period of time.

INVESTMENT OBJECTIVES
Investing is the proactive use of your money to make more money or, to say it another way, it is your money working for you.

The options for investing our savings are continually increasing, yet every single investment vehicle can be easily categorized according to three fundamental characteristics - safety, income and growth - which also correspond to types of investor objectives. While it is possible for an investor to have more than one of these objectives, the success of one must come at the expense of others.
